KS Ong 1 Report post Posted December 15, 2015 Just a quick run around in the economy (World Traveller) section. It seats 3-3-3 @ 31" pitch For the last row, it seats 2-3-2 (Row 43). There is quite a free space between the seat and the window. You can probably place a small hand carry there. Seat 41A/K is windowless. Media boxes are places under some seats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
